Contributors give to Empty Stocking Fund
The Empty Stocking Fund, organized by The Herald, is an annual holiday assistance effort to help needy families in the newspaper's readership area.
Contributions to the Empty Stocking Fund can be mailed to P.O. Box 10921, Rock Hill, SC 29731, or dropped off at The Herald, 132 W. Main St., Rock Hill. Contributors' names will be published in The Herald.

Local students win art exhibit awards
The annual ChristmasVille Festival featured a special art exhibit by York County high school students at the Center for the Arts on Main Street and will continue all month. Awards were given as follows:
• First place: Adam Eddy of Fort Mill High School, $250.
• Second place: Paul Nguyen of Northwestern High School, $150.
• Third place: Emilia Munoz-Bowman of Rock Hill High School, $100.
• Honorable mentions: Bryn Holler, Katherine Keener and Ashley Adams of Northwestern High School; Ryanne Brodeur of York High School and Hannah Robinson of Rock Hill High School.
Rock Hill High student in running for scholarship
Margaret V. East, a student at Rock Hill High School, is a semifinalist for the 2009 Class of the Coca-Cola Scholars Program.
East ranks with approximately 2,142 high school seniors who are in the running for $3 million in college scholarships, which will be awarded in spring 2009.
